Charity

Holiday season is the time of giving and I wanted to share some of the giving the Tyler MQG has done this year.


Quilts for Pulse - Organized by the Orlando MQG to collect quilts and blocks for the victims of the shooting at Pulse nightclub on June 12, 2016 - Our Guild donated 5 Quilts






Quilts for Peace - Organized by the Dallas MQG - Donations of blue and white blocks for the fallen and injured officers that were killed during a protest in Dallas, TX - Our guild donated several blocks including many that were signed by officers.  We received a lovely thank you note from the DMQG.
